Can I invest 3000 euros in Bitcoin long-term instead of riskier altcoins or gambling day trading? And is it wise to use centralized exchanges despite key ownership concerns?
Based on my experience, investing directly in Bitcoin is a conservative and steady approach to entering the crypto space. Bitcoin has established its value over time with a track record that many emerging cryptocurrencies do not yet offer. It is wise to begin with centralized exchanges to build familiarity with market practices, but I recommend transferring funds to secure wallets as you gain confidence in safeguarding your assets. Gradually educating yourself on key management and storage practices greatly contributes to long-term success in this unpredictable market.
